    STUDY OF KEEPING PROBIOTIC PROPERTIES OF SOUR-CREAM BUTTER AT STORAGE

    No full text
    The aim of the work was the study of keeping probiotic properties of sour-milk butter with inclusion of Lactobacillus acidophilus La-5 (La-5) monoculture. Flora Danica mesophile culture independently (FD); in combination with La-5 and La-5 independently were used for fermenting cream. The output consistence of culture in cream was 1×106 CFU/cm3. In autumn-winter and spring-summer period of the year four butter groups were prepared, they differed by temperature of cream fermentation: I group – (30±1) ºС; II – (37±1) ºС; III – stage regimes of combination of fermentation and physical maturing; IV group – introduction of cultures into oil kernel; the output concentration – 1·108 CFU/cm3. As to the features of summer and winter periods, in summer one cream fermentation is more active that is indicated by more number of cells of both microbial cultures. The best parameters of viable cells keeping were typical to the samples at FD+La-5 use and temperature of cream fermentation (30±1) ºС. Storage life of sour-cream butter with probiotic properties is 35 days at temperature 0…-5 ºС

    Research Into Probiotic Properties of Cultured Butter During Storing

    Full text link
    The purpose of experimental research was to determine the number of viable cells L. acidophilus of the strain La-5 and Flora Danica when storing cultured butter. For this purpose, we employed different temperature modes of the fermentation of cream, as well as various technologies. The original concentration of cultures in cream is 1•106 cfu/cm3; with a combination of cultures – the ratio of 1:1 at original concentration in cream of 1•106 and 1•106 cfu/cm3, respectively). We prepared 4 groups of butter:– group I (samples BW (Butter Winter)1, BW2, BW3 and BS (Butter Summer)1, BS2, BS3 at souring the cream by FD, FD + La-5, La-5, respectively, in winter and summer). Cream fermentation was conducted at temperature (30±1) ºC;– group II (BW4, BW5, BW6, BS5, BS6, BS7 at souring by FD, FD+La-5; La-5) – fermentation (37±1) ºC;– group III (З7, З8, З9 at souring by FD, FD+La-5, La-5, respectively) – (8±1) ºC→(20±1) ºC→(12±1) ºC – winter stepwise cultured butter production mode similar to the Alnarp mode. (BS7, BS8, BS9) – (20±1) ºC→(6±1) ºC→(10±1) ºC – summer stepwise mode similar to the Danish one;– group IV (BW10, BW11, BW12, BS10, BS11, BS12 at souring by FD, FD+La-5, La-5, respectively) – introduction of souring cultures to a butter grain. The original concentration of cells at inoculation – 1•108 cfu/cm3.The largest number of viable cells of La-5 was registered for the sample in which we used FD+La-5 and the fermentation of cream at temperature (30±1) ºC. Duration of storing the cultured butter with the probiotic properties is 35 days at temperature 0…–5 º
